Default Gretsch G9220 Bobtail Roundneck Resonator... and other reso questions

I've got the itch for one of these (pm if u have a used one you wanna let go). I know it's the same as the Boxcar with the sunburst and Spider - FishmanŽ Nashville pickup.

My question is... will the FishmanŽ Nashville pickup (passive I think) work with my K&K Pure XLR Preamp? I have K&K pups on other guitars so it would be great to be able to use the same preamp.

Also, I've been listening to Mike Dowling, Bob Brozman and Kelly Jo Phelps. The "reso bug" just bit some I'm hungry for more. Who else should I listen to that plays fingerstyle (as opposed to slide/the classic Robert Johnson/Elmore James style... love it but just not where I'm at right now.)? I'm into jazz, country swing, gypsy swing, blues, hawaiian, folk, world, country, and I guess... anything folk and rootsy.
